[VIDEO] Observation deck at Tokyo’s Toyosu fish market opens to public

The observation deck at the Toyosu wholesale fish market opened its doors to the public on Jan. 15, 2019, including to the viewing area — an elevated, glass-panelled deck overlooking the tuna auction rooms.
